POSITION DESCRIPTION:
The Energy Analyst will be a member of a team that is responsible for acquiring, validating, and analyzing data about energy.
The Energy Analyst has responsibility for analyzing utility bills and consumption data and responds to demand-side project managers and energy engineer’s requests for research and reporting to support project and customer needs. The energy analyst is responsible for providing reports and documentation, which are communicated within the team and to the customers if necessary.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ES / P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ES:
Assist the team with the management of customer utility billing data.
Update and validate utility data for commercial sites and accounts.
Assist with the creation of monthly utility performance reports, consumption, and cost variance analysis.
Create reports as needed for engineering analysis looking for anomalies in data or the behavior of sites concerning energy.
Utilize SQL relational databases and Excel to analyze energy data.
Update and maintain client site specific data (e.g. new store openings, closings, owners/managers, site address, square footage, etc.)
Assist with special projects, and client requests (e.g. audits, site research, etc.)
Ability to analyze data to find and quantify savings opportunities.
Must be able to create Excel spreadsheets that represent an audit of transactions and provide summarization of same.
